LTC4269CDKD-1#PBF - Integrated IEEE 802.3at Power over Ethernet Interface Controller
The LTC4269CDKD-1#PBF is an advanced Power over Ethernet (PoE) interface controller from Linear Technology, designed to simplify the implementation of PoE functionality in Ethernet-connected devices. It is fully compliant with the IEEE 802.3at standard, providing an end-to-end solution for delivering power over Ethernet cabling to powered devices (PDs). This product is ideal for applications such as remote wireless access points, security cameras, IP phones, and other networked devices that benefit from a centralized power source.
At the heart of the LTC4269CDKD-1#PBF is a robust PoE interface and a high-efficiency, switch-mode power supply controller. The integrated controller is capable of delivering up to 25.5 watts of power to the PD, ensuring a reliable power source for even the most demanding applications. It features an advanced signature detection and classification engine, which allows it to accurately detect the presence of a valid PoE power sourcing equipment (PSE) and to classify the power level required by the PD.
The LTC4269CDKD-1#PBF offers a comprehensive set of protection features to ensure the safety and reliability of the PoE system. It includes under-voltage lockout (UVLO), over-current protection, over-temperature protection, and robust thermal management capabilities. These features protect both the PD and the PSE from potential damage caused by electrical anomalies.
Designed for flexibility, the LTC4269CDKD-1#PBF supports a wide input voltage range and can be easily configured to meet the specific needs of various applications. It is available in a compact, thermally enhanced DFN package, which facilitates efficient heat dissipation and saves valuable board space.
